Summary
The St. James Township Board authorized formation of a Gull Harbor Natural Area (GHNA) Committee on January 21, 2026. The approved minutes name four Island representatives and provide for participation from Little Traverse Conservancy. By July, a forum advocacy notice described continuing community disagreement about the committee’s transparency and the future of historic motorized access.
Evidence and limits
The same action authorized the Committee to apply to the Charlevoix County Community Foundation for a management plan and some improvements. It is not evidence that a grant was awarded, a plan was prepared, a committee meeting was held, or any improvement was completed. The minutes do not supply bylaws, full membership terms, decision-making rules, or continuing authority. The July forum account should be read as evidence that these issues were being publicly contested, not as proof of the account’s allegations about EGLE, conflicts, road status, or township procedure.
